The Traders Point Christian Knights will square off against the Purdue Broad Ripple Lynx at 6:00 p.m. on Friday. Traders Point Christian is looking for their season's first win.
Traders Point Christian is headed in fresh off scoring the most points they have all season. They fell to Indiana School for the Deaf 45-39.
Meanwhile, Purdue Broad Ripple didn't have too much trouble with MTI School of Knowledge on Tuesday as they won 31-17.
Purdue Broad Ripple found their leader in freshman Nadia Harris, who earned 21 points. The team also got some help courtesy of Keira Hefleng, who had six points.
The victory got Purdue Broad Ripple back to even at 1-1. As for Traders Point Christian, their defeat dropped their record down to 0-6.
